I'm reading That Hideous Strength by C.S. Lewis and he uses some of the coolest words ever.

The Warden Shovel surrounded the Wood with a wall "for the taking away of all profane and heathenish superstitions and the deterring of the vulgar sort from all wakes, may games, dancings, mummings, and baking of Morgan's bread, heretofore used about the fountain called in vanity Merlin's Well, and utterly to be renounced and abominatied as a gallimaufrey of papistry, gentilism, lewdness and dunisicall folly."

Anyways that doesn't make perfect sense but the word 'gallimaufrey' is just the best.
